UGC is responsible to the management and smooth running of activities in educational institutions by facilitating them with guidance and commands under the UGC Act(1993) with a distribution of awards to colleges and advanced education organizationswith an accompanying capacities: Allocation of government grants touniversities and higher education institutions through policies formulation; Providing proposals in overhauling the provision of grants and dispensing the grants to universities and colleges; Award grants for research, scholarships, and fellowships; Quantifying actions to maintain the guidelines of higher education; On the matters concerning operations/actions of education institution(s) or establishment of the new universities in an affiliation to foreign universities/institutions; Logistics management such as the exchange of resources, funds, and fellowships between universities and educational institutions within and outside Nepal. The University Council is the supreme body that makes decisions on policies, budget, rules and regulations and the formation of special committees and commissions. In the context of changing scenario of education system at central departments of Tribhuvan University, CDS adopted the semester system in 2012 for 2-year (4 semesters, six months in each semester) Masters Degree study in Statistics with some major changes in curriculum which was then revised in 2015 with 64 credits primarily to maintain uniformity amongst IOST central departments as regards to the allocation of total credits for the program, evaluation scheme and also keeping in view of the international norms of the semester system. For any qualified Ph.D. candidate, relevant coursework must be proposed as per institutional standards, including Mandatory Coursework on Philosophy and Methodology of 12 credit hours and 6 credit hours of Selective Coursework. The Research Coordination Council makes policies on TU research activities, approves guidelines for researchers and coordinates the functions of university level research organizations.
